Residential fires restriction lifted
Posted September 7, 2018
Kitsap County Fire Marshal, David Lynam
(Port Orchard, WA) – The Kitsap County Fire Marshall has lifted the prohibition on
recreational fires in Kitsap County. Recreational fires in approved locations and in
appliances can resume immediately.
"Cooler weather, shorter days and a more fall-like weather forecasts allows us to lift the
recreational fire ban," said David Lynam, County Fire Marshall. "Fire danger is still
precarious, and caution is still the name of the game," Lyman added.
A Phase 1 burn ban remains in effect. Officials expect it will remain in effect until rain
arrives in the fall.
REMINDER: General back yard burning as well as land clearing is prohibited and all burning permits
will be suspended for the immediate future until the ban is lifted. Recreational fires must be 3 feet or less
in size, in a designated fire pit using only charcoal or dry firewood (no milled lumber). Fires must be
constantly attended until fully extinguished and at least one piece of fire-extinguishing equipment must
be on-site and available for immediate use while burning.

Most people know that eating fruits and vegetables is important for good health,
but most of us still aren’t getting enough. This September is Fruits & Veggies –
More Matters Month and a great reminder to eat your fruits and veggies!
Eating a healthy diet with plenty of vegetables and fruits can help you:
Lower your risk for heart disease and some types of cancer
Maintain or reach a healthy weight
Keep your body strong and active
Here are some ideas to help you and your family fit more fruits and vegetables into
your day:
Keep a bowl of fruit handy where the whole family can see it.
Cut up fruits and veggies ahead of time so they’re ready for quick,
healthy snacks.
Challenge your family to try a new veggie or fruit every week.
Remember, eating more fruits and veggies can be fun — and it’s worth it!
